Embracing Emotional Stability at the Table
One of the defining traits of successful bridge players is their ability to remain unflappable after making a mistake. Setbacks and poor outcomes are inevitable, but dwelling on a bad board only compromises future decisions. Learning to immediately reset your mental state prevents small missteps from escalating into larger match-ending disasters.
Maintaining composure also fosters a better dynamic between partners. Encouraging your partner through difficult hands helps maintain mutual trust and keeps communication clear. Emotional resilience ensures that both players stay focused on executing sound strategies rather than placing blame.
Building Focus Through Systematic Preparation
Consistent concentration over long matches requires deliberate mental preparation before play even begins. Establishing a structured pre-game routine allows players to enter the table with a calm and ready mindset. Reviewing fundamental bidding agreements or practicing visualization techniques can sharpen your analytical thinking before the first deal.
During active play, managing your cognitive energy is essential for avoiding mid-session fatigue. Taking brief mental breaks between hands helps clear clutter from previous rounds. Adopting a Growth-Oriented Perspective
A true winning mindset frames every loss and error as an opportunity for tactical growth. Analyzing completed hands post-match provides valuable insights into flawed deductions or missed defensive opportunities. Adopting a growth mindset allows players to view challenging opponents as valuable teachers rather than intimidating obstacles.
Focusing on long-term skill development reduces the anxiety associated with short-term scoring fluctuations. Celebrating small improvements in card counting or table awareness builds authentic confidence over time. This continuous learning process ensures steady progress and long-term enjoyment of the game.
Fostering Strong Partnership Communication
Bridge is ultimately a collaborative effort, meaning your mindset must align with your partner's expectations and style. Clear and respectful signaling combined with empathetic listening creates a seamless cooperative flow. Trusting your partner's choices eliminates unnecessary guesswork and strengthens your defensive alignment.
When both players share a constructive attitude, the team becomes significantly more resilient against aggressive opponents. Prioritizing clear communication transforms two individual players into a unified tactical force. A shared commitment to mutual support is often the ultimate differentiator in competitive bridge.
